BKLN Hedge Fund Activity: Q4 2014 in Review

277 of the 3,749 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in Invesco Senior Loan ETF (BKLN) for Q4 2014, worth a combined $2.96B — down 8.8% from $3.25B a quarter earlier.

Buyers outnumbered sellers: 56 funds opened new BKLN positions and 39 closed out — a net gain of 17 holders — while 74 added to existing stakes and 127 trimmed.

The largest buyer was Manulife (Manufacturers Life Insurance), adding an estimated $187M. The largest seller was Bank of America, cutting an estimated $108M.
